B is in Ad. Seg and he told me that thier orders had been sent back, so he could not buy stamps, and since he's in Seg they are not allowed to send out mail indigent if they have money on their book. But in General Pop they are allowed to send out mail indigent and have it drawn off their book, so unless your hunny is in Ad. Seg you should receive mail. :) Maybe not as fast as you'd like, but still :)

Long story on him getting medium security....let's just say he wrote a letter to an girl he was dating and it was considered extortion. According to legal description it wasn't extortion but we didn't fight it. That is how he got in Allred to begin with. While in medium security he was housed with a high ranking Mandingo Warrior who extorted all his commissary, threatened to kill him...on and on. When he had enough he went to gang intelligence for help. They DID NOT investigate the accusation because one of the guards was in cahoots with the Mandingo......corruption to the hilt. As usual, since my son is a con....and believe a con is a con (but I love him) I checked into everything. They blew it...not us and they threw him right back into the same pod. It took two Ombudsman investigations and two state representatives to get the job done. He is now in Boyd where there is NO active gang activity. As a matter of fact, the warden has a group come in and talk to x gang members so they can get out and not re-enter the gangs. Boyd is like heaven...my son gets to attend AA ...something he couldn't do in Allred. The warden at Boyd really has things under control and the entire staff I have had contact with are great. He even has a questionnaire about how you are treated when you visit there. He is into the men acting like men, begin treated like decent people and getting their time done. He also doesn't put up with any crap so if they screw up he has them transferred. Most of the units has gang activity but some have gangs running the show and I personally think Allred is one of them.
